6& 7 In the matter of approving the assessment of benefits, costs and expenses
for the construction of sanitary sewer service connections as part of the
Case/Hazelwood area RSVP Project.
PreliminaYy Order: 00-832 approved: Sentember 13, 2000
Final Order: 00-1097 approved: November 15, 2000
The assessment of benefits, cost and expenses for and in connection with the
above improvements having been submitted to the Council, and the Council having
considered same and found the said assessment satisfactory, therefore, be it
RSSOLVED, That the said assessments be and the same are hereby in all respects
approved.
RESOLVED FURTIiER, That a public hearing be had on said assessment on the 2nd
day of April, 2003, at the hour of 5:30 o'clock P.M., in the Council Chamber of the
Court House and City Hall Building, in the City of St. Paul; that the Valuation and
Assessment Engineer give notice of said meetings, as required by the Charter, stating
in said notice the time and place of hearing, the nature of the improvement, and the
amount assessed against the lot or lots of the particular owner to whom the notice
is directed.
